A quantitative analysis of the kinetics of the G2 DNA damage checkpoint system
96
Corrected several mistakes in the parameters as specified by the errata list supplied by the model author:
1) kn8 = 0.01
2) k17, k2, k2_ = 0.1
Also, the rates Vex and Vin were added into the equations:
1) d/dt(iCdc25) = vm7+vm3p+vin-(v7+v2p)
2) d/dt(iCdc25Ps2161433) = v3p-(vm3p+vex)

This is the CellML description of Aguda's 1999 quantitative analysis of the kinetics of the G2 DNA damage checkpoint system
This CellML version of the models runs in PCEnv to reproduce the results shown in figure 8 of the published paper. Units have been checked and are consistent.
